How can I rotate an ellipse randomly

Emma on 3 Mar 2021
Edited: Walter Roberson on 3 Mar 2021
This is what I have written so far
t = linspace(0,2*pi)
x = randn + randn*cos(t)
y = randn + randn*sin(t);
I want to create random rotation for this ellipse each time I plot it while keeping this same code I have written so far.
Emma on 3 Mar 2021
sorry one more question. I am very new to matlab so what exactly would you type to rotate randomly around (xc,yc)? And how do you inetgrate it into the code you wrote?

